Mansfield street resurfacing bids come in slightly below $5.3 million estimate
MANSFIELD — Both bids submitted for the City of Mansfield 2022 street resurfacing program came in below the engineer’s estimated cost of $5.3 million. Mifflin council replaces solicitor Michael Brown with Loudonville attorney
MIFFLIN — Mifflin’s Village Council fired its solicitor, Michael Brown, during a special meeting Thursday. The vote was unanimous; however, two council members — Joyce Amos, who is suspended, and Pam Crain — were absent. Mayor Vickie Shultz also did not attend the meeting.
